01_Capacity vs Coverage☾ Capacity1초에 전송할 수 있는 데이터량 ☾ Coverage데이터의 범위Capacity와 Coverage는 반비례 관계Capacity와 Frequency band는 비례 관계frequency ↓ → range ↑ → rate ↓frequency ↑ → range ↓ → rate ↑ 02_Internet☾ Internetnetwork of networks작은 네트워크 여러 개가 연결되어 있는 광범위한 네트워크의 집합 hostsend systems packet switchespacket을 전달하는 역할packet : 데이터를 전달할 때 자르는 단위 communication links어떤 방법으로 데이터를 전달할지fiber(섬유), copper(..
01_조인(JOIN)☾ 조인한 테이블의 행을 다른 테이블의 행에 연결해 두 개 이상의 테이블을 결합관계 대수의 카티션 프로덕트 연산같은 속성 이름을 사용하는 테이블이 두 개 이상일 경우, ‘테이블이름.열이름‘ 형식으로 표현하여 열 이름이 어느 테이블과 연관되는지 정확히 명시해야 한다.-- 고객과 고객의 주문에 관한 데이터를 모두 나타내시오.SELECT *FROM Customer, OrdersWHERE Customer.custid=Orders.custid; LEFT OUTER JOIN-- 도서를 구매하지 않은 고객을 포함해 고객의 이름과 고객이 주문한 도서의 판매가격을 구하시오.SELECT Customer.name, salepriceFROM Customer LEFT OUTER JOIN Orders ON C..
01_데이터 조작어(DML: data manipulation language) - 삽입, 수정, 삭제☾ 데이터 조작어테이블에 데이터를 검색, 삽입, 수정, 삭제하는 데 사용SELECT, INSERT, DELETE UPDATE문 등 INSERT테이블에 새로운 튜플 삽입INSERT INTO 테이블이름[(속성리스트)] VALUES (값리스트);INSERT INTO Constructors(constructor, engine, country, races_entered, height, width)VALUES('McLaren', 'Mercedes', 'British', 884, 95, 180); 속성의 이름을 생략할 때는 데이터의 입력 순서와 속성의 순서가 일치해야 한다.INSERT INTO Constructo..
데이터 정의어(DDL: data definition language)☾ 데이터 정의어테이블이나 관계의 구조를 생성하는 데 사용CREATE, ALTER DROP문 등 CREATE테이블 생성속성과 속성에 관한 제약 정의기본키 및 외래키 정의CREATE TABLE 테이블이름 (속성이름 데이터타입 [NULL | NOT NULL | UNIQUE | DEFAULT 기본값 | CHECK 체크조건][PRIMARY KEY 속성이름][FOREIGN KEY 속성이름 REFERENCES 테이블이름(속성이름) [ON DELETE {NO ACTION | CASCADE | SET NULL | SET DEFAULT}]]); AUTO_INCREMENT : 데이터가 삽입될 때 고유번호가 자동으로 생성됨(기본적으로 매 데이터마다 ..
01_SQL 개요☾ SQL(Structured Query Language)프로그래밍 언어가 아닌 데이터 부속어(data sublanguage)비절차적 언어데이터와 메타 데이터를 생성하고 처리하는 문법만 존재입력과 출력 모두 테이블 ☾ MySQL오픈 소스 관계형 DBMSANSI SQL99 표준의 일부를 따름 ☾ 릴레이션 관련 용어릴레이션 용어 실무에서 사용하는 용어릴레이션(relation)테이블(table)속성(attribute)열(column)튜플(tuple)행(row) 02_데이터베이스 명령어 CREATE데이터베이스 생성CREATE DATABASE 데이터베이스이름; SHOW데이터베이스 목록 조회SHOW DATABASES; USE데이터베이스 사용USE 데이터베이스이름; DRO..
Android Studio 특정 버전 설치1. Android Studio 버전 확인아래 사이트에 접속하여 원하는 버전을 찾는다. https://plugins.jetbrains.com/docs/intellij/android-studio-releases-list.html Android Studio Releases List | IntelliJ Platform Plugin SDK plugins.jetbrains.com version 부분을 복사한다. 2. Windows 설치 방법{version} 부분에 복사한 텍스트를 붙여넣는다. 인터넷 주소창에 입력하면 다운로드가 시작된다. https://redirector.gvt1.com/edgedl/android/studio/install/{version}/android-..